Ilminster is a medieval former market town, situated about 12 miles south east of the county town of Taunton. Surrounded by undulating open countryside designated a Special Landscape area, the majority of the town falls within a Conservation Area with many character properties built of the local mellow Hamstone. The ancient Minster dominates the centre of the town. Ilminster offers a full range of amenities including doctors, dentist, shopping facilities and weekly market. The town also benefits from an arts centre and theatre. There is schooling at primary and intermediate levels and churches of various denominations. Ilminster has convenient road access to both the M5, junction 25 lies 11 miles to the north-west and to the A303, now dual carriageway most of the way to the M3. Mainline railway stations are situated at Crewkerne 7 miles (London Waterloo) and Taunton 13 miles (London Paddington). Berrys coaches offer a service to London twice a day. Bath, Bristol and Exeter offer excellent cultural and shopping facilities within easy travelling distance. The World Heritage designated coastline lies 18 miles to the South.
